Selecting the Right Size and Type of Nitrile Glove

When it comes to handling hazardous materials, selecting the appropriate nitrile glove is crucial for your well-being. Nitrile gloves offer exceptional shield against a wide range of agents, making them a popular choice in industries such as healthcare, manufacturing, and analysis.

To ensure optimal efficacy, consider these factors: Size is paramount. A glove that's too tight can restrict dexterity while one that's too flappy can compromise protection. Use a size chart provided by the producer to determine your ideal size.

The density of the nitrile glove also plays a crucial role in determining its level of safety. Heavier gloves offer greater resistance to damage, making them suitable for handling more aggressive materials.

  • Unpowdered Gloves: Consider your work. Powdered gloves can reduce friction and make it easier to put on the glove, but they can also contribute to allergies or irritate sensitive skin. Unpowdered gloves are a safer choice for individuals with allergies or those working in clean environments.
  • Plain Surfaces: Textured surfaces provide increased hold, which is particularly important when handling wet or oily materials. Plain gloves offer a more precise touch, suitable for tasks requiring fine motor skills.

Nitrile Gloves Offer Enhanced Safety in Healthcare

In the healthcare industry, patient health is paramount. Healthcare professionals consistently face risks from exposure to infectious agents. To mitigate these threats, nitrile gloves have emerged as a vital protective measure.

Nitrile gloves provide an effective shield against a diverse array of pathogens, including bacteria, viruses, and fungi. Their inertness to many common disinfectants and medical agents further enhances their utility.

Beyond their protective qualities, nitrile gloves offer dexterity, allowing healthcare providers to perform tasks with finesse. Their toughness endures punctures and tears, minimizing the risk of accidental exposure. Choosing suitable sized nitrile gloves is crucial for ensuring a tight fit that prevents gaps.

  • Additionally, nitrile gloves are hypoallergenic, making them suitable for healthcare workers with allergies.
  • Frequent inspection of gloves before and during use is essential to identify any damage that may compromise their integrity.
  • Appropriate disposal of used nitrile gloves in designated waste receptacles helps prevent the spread of infections.
